" Vim script to cleanup a .po file: " - Remove line numbers (avoids that diffs are messy). " - Comment-out fuzzy and empty messages. " - Make sure there is a space before the string (required for Solaris). " Requires Vim 6.0 or later (because of multi-line search patterns). " Disable diff mode, because it makes this very slow let s:was_diff = &diff setl nodiff " untranslated message preceded by c-format or comment silent g/^#, c-format\n#/.d silent g/^#\..*\n#/.d silent g/^#[:~] /d silent g/^#, fuzzy\(, .*\)\=\nmsgid ""\@!/.+1,/^$/-1s/^/#\~ / silent g/^msgstr"/s//msgstr "/ silent g/^msgid"/s//msgid "/ silent g/^msgstr ""\(\n"\)\@!/?^msgid?,.s/^/#\~ / silent g/^\n\n\n/.d if s:was_diff setl diff endif
